How much do tv show j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for tv show in the United States is $54,604.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$39,500.00 and $71,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a TV show?

A TV show is a series of episodes produced for broadcast on television, streaming platforms, or online. TV shows can be scripted, like dramas and comedies, or unscripted, like reality and talk shows. They are typically organized into seasons, with each season containing multiple episodes. TV shows can vary widely in genre, length, and format, catering to diverse audiences. The primary purpose is to entertain, inform, or educate viewers through recurring content.

What are the most common challenges faced by professionals working on a TV show production team?

Professionals working on a TV show production team often face tight deadlines and rapidly changing schedules, which require strong organizational and problem-solving skills. Coordinating between various departments—such as writing, filming, editing, and marketing—can be challenging, as each has its own workflow and priorities. Additionally, adapting to last-minute script changes or technical issues during filming is a common occurrence, so flexibility and effective communication are essential. Despite these challenges, working on a TV show offers valuable opportunities to collaborate creatively and build a diverse skill set within the entertainment industry.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a TV Show Producer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a TV Show Producer, you need a strong background in media production, project management, and script development, often supported by a degree in film,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with production software, editing tools like Avid or Adobe Premiere, and budgeting systems is typically required. Leadership, creativity, and excellent communication skills help producers manage teams and bring creative visions to life. These skills are essential for delivering high-quality content on time and within budget, ensuring the show's success and audience engagement.
